#429f98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#429f98 is composed of 25.9% red, 62.4%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 175.5 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 44.1%. #429f98 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ffff with #003f31.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#429f98 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#429f98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#429f98 has RGB values of R:66, G:159,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 4366232.

Shades and Tints of #429f98
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030706 is the darkest color, while #f8fcfc is the lightest one.
